Output 8078321f61eaf69c23cdb577d7ca1234e156c6e6135bb9acfb408647c0d10390:0

value
6974330335777
script pubkey
OP_0 OP_PUSHBYTES_20 6f42ef0517b491ac464621f7097836301736a5d2
address
tb1qdapw7pghkjg6c3jxy8msj7pkxqtndfwj68l0rs
transaction
8078321f61eaf69c23cdb577d7ca1234e156c6e6135bb9acfb408647c0d10390
spent
true